Subject: On-call handover — nightly reindex

Handing off Lumenbase search. Nightly reindex failed twice this week on the `catalog` shard; rerun via `reindex --shard catalog` if it dies again. Watch disk on indexer-3 — it's at 82%. Runbook is current. No other open issues. If anything looks off beyond the runbook, escalate to the search platform rotation at the address below.

escalation mailbox, yajeg-bageg: quenax.olidor@lumiccorp.internal

### Changed defaults

Heads up: the Gondola pricing experiment now defaults to a 5% exploration rate instead of 15%, after the last cohort showed too much price churn on weekend events. Floor and ceiling multipliers got tightened too. Nothing changes for events already in flight. Please sanity-check the rollout logic against the new defaults, listed here.

service settings:
PRAIX_LOG_LEVEL=error
PRAIX_METRICS_HOST=metrics.praix.qorvelcorp.corp
PRAIX_POOL_SIZE=16

Subject: Forgecastle cut-over complete

Team — the Marrow build migrated to Forgecastle (hermetic builds) Friday night. Legacy build path is disabled; old scripts removed Monday. Build times down ~40%, cache hit rate at 91%. Two known issues: codegen step needs a pinned toolchain, and the docs target still fetches remotely — fixes tracked. Full details at sync. The production build now runs with these values.

service settings:
[casax]
port = 6379
team = rusir
host = casax.zemvarhq.corp
region = outer-4
access_code = ac_9808ce
timeout_ms = 1500